DOE awards $149K internet contract to Cincinnati Bell Telephone Company LLC for wired telecommunications services
Contract Overview
Contract Amount: $149,030 ($149.0K)
Contractor: Cincinnati Bell Telephone Company LLC
Awarding Agency: Department of Energy
Start Date: 2019-01-31
End Date: 2023-05-31
Contract Duration: 1,581 days
Daily Burn Rate: $94/day
Competition Type: COMPETED UNDER SAP
Number of Offers Received: 5
Pricing Type: FIRM FIXED PRICE
Sector: IT
Official Description: INTERNET SERVICE CONTRACT FOR EMCBC
Place of Performance
Location: CINCINNATI, HAMILTON County, OHIO, 45202

Competition Analysis
Competition Level: limited
The contract was competed under SAP (Simplified Acquisition Procedures), which typically involves limited competition. This method may not always yield the lowest possible price compared to full and open competition.
Taxpayer Impact: Taxpayer funds are used for essential internet services. The pricing appears fair, but the limited competition might mean slightly higher costs than could be achieved through broader bidding.
